DescriptionThis chapel site site is located some 250m north of Bettws farm. Until the mid-nineteenth century, bones and peices of coffin (including brass fittings and coffin boards) were reportedly regularly turned up during ploughing in the vicinity of the site. A holy water stoup is also noted to have been recovered. The chapel site is currently visible as a banked enclosure, and the present farm and adjacent woodland preserve its name.
